Discover the Fascinating World of Cryptography: Unlocking Coded Messages
Cryptography, the art and science of writing and deciphering secret codes, has been a subject of fascination and intrigue throughout history. From ancient civilizations to modern digital systems, cryptography plays a crucial role in securing sensitive information and protecting communication. In this article, we will explore the fascinating world of cryptography, its history, techniques, and its significance in today’s digital age.
Historical Origins:
The origins of cryptography can be traced back thousands of years. Ancient civilizations, such as the Egyptians, Greeks, and Romans, developed early encryption methods to transmit secret messages during times of war and espionage. One notable example is the Caesar cipher, won this page letters in a message are shifted by a certain number of positions to create a secret code.
Encryption Techniques:
Encryption is the process of converting plaintext into ciphertext, making it unreadable without the appropriate decryption key. Modern cryptography employs various encryption techniques, including symmetric key encryption, won this page the same key is used for both encryption and decryption, and asymmetric key encryption, which uses a pair of mathematically related keys—public and private keys—for encryption and decryption.
Digital Encryption:
In the digital age, cryptography plays a crucial role in securing digital communication and sensitive data. Techniques such as the Advanced Encryption Standard (AES) and RSA (Rivest-Shamir-Adleman) algorithm are widely used to protect data during transmission and storage. These algorithms use complex mathematical operations to create encryption keys and perform secure encryption and decryption.
Cryptanalysis:
Cryptanalysis is the process of deciphering coded messages without the original decryption key. Throughout history, cryptanalysts have employed various techniques, including frequency analysis and brute-force attacks, to break encryption codes. The ability to break codes has often played a pivotal role in military strategies and intelligence gathering.
Cryptography in Modern Applications:
Cryptography is a critical component of modern applications and systems, ensuring secure transactions, data privacy, and authentication. It is used in online banking, e-commerce, secure messaging applications, and secure file transfer protocols. Cryptographic protocols, such as SSL/TLS, establish secure connections over the internet, safeguarding sensitive information from unauthorized access.
Quantum Cryptography:
Quantum cryptography is an emerging field that utilizes principles of quantum mechanics to provide secure communication. Quantum key distribution (QKD) enables the secure exchange of encryption keys, as any eavesdropping attempt would disturb the quantum state and be detected. Quantum cryptography has the potential to enhance security in future communication systems.
Ethical Considerations:
Cryptography raises ethical considerations regarding privacy, surveillance, and national security. Balancing the need for secure communication with the requirements of law enforcement and intelligence agencies is a subject of ongoing debate. Striking a balance that protects individuals’ privacy rights while ensuring public safety remains a challenge in the digital age.
Cryptography is a captivating field that has evolved over centuries, shaping the course of history and revolutionizing the way we communicate and protect sensitive information. From ancient ciphers to modern encryption algorithms, cryptography continues to play a vital role in safeguarding digital communication, ensuring secure transactions, and protecting data privacy. Exploring the fascinating world of cryptography reveals the intricate techniques, challenges, and ethical considerations involved in the art of coding and decoding secret messages. As technology advances, cryptography will continue to evolve, addressing new challenges and providing innovative solutions to protect our digital world.
Recent Comments